java.sql.SQLException: Access denied for user ''@'localhost' (using password: YES)
记2018.11.18的两个个小问题:
java.sql.SQLException: Access denied for user ''@'localhost' (using password: YES)
解决办法:
spring:datasource:#2018.11.18莫名出现环境问题,以后只能采用拼接的写法,这是低版本写法driver-class-name: com.mysql.jdbc.Driverurl: jdbc:mysql://127.0.0.1:3306/demo?useUnicode=true&characterEncoding=UTF-8#高版本写法(8.0以上),serverTimezone=GMT解决时区问题#driver-class-name: com.mysql.cj.jdbc.Driver#url: jdbc:mysql://127.0.0.1:3306/demo?characterEncoding=utf-8&serverTimezone=GMT&useSSL=false&user=root&password=0219
使用拼接写法后,又遇到高版本Mysql8.0.12上的时区问题:
java.sql.SQLException: The server time zone value 'Öйú±ê׼ʱ¼ä' is unrecognized or represents more than one time zone. You must configure either the server or JDBC driver (via the serverTimezone configuration property) to use a more specifc time zone value if you want to utilize time zone support.
使用的数据库是MySQL,从上面看出SpringBoot2.1在你没有指定MySQL驱动版本的情况下它自动依赖的驱动是8.0.12很高的版本,这是由于数据库和系统时区差异所造成的,在jdbc连接的url后面加上serverTimezone=GMT即可解决问题。再一个解决办法就是使用低版本的MySQL jdbc驱动,5.1.28不会存在时区的问题。
java.sql.SQLException: Access denied for user ''@'localhost' (using password: YES)相关推荐
- java.sql.SQLException: Access denied for user ‘‘@‘localhost‘ (using password: NO)报错问题解决
java.sql.SQLException: Access denied for user ''@'localhost' (using password: NO)报错问题解决 参考文章: (1)jav ...
- java.sql.SQLException: Access denied for user ''@'localhost' (using password: YES)出现原因及解决方法
今天学习使用JDBC连接池,使用Druid德鲁伊连接池操作mysql数据库,写了一个Druid的工具类,在测试类中调用获取连接对象执行SQL语句的时候出现错误:java.sql.SQLExceptio ...
- java.sql.SQLException: Access denied for user ''@'localhost' (using password: NO)问题解决,很详细,很详细,很详细
java.sql.SQLException: Access denied for user ''@'localhost' (using password: NO)问题: 前提:确认用户名,密码,url ...
- 完美解析解决java.sql.SQLException:Access denied for user ‘‘@‘localhost‘ (using password: NO)
用springboot项目连接数据库时报了这个错误java.sql.SQLException: Access denied for user 'root'@'localhost' (using pas ...
- idea提示java.sql.SQLException: Access denied for user ‘‘@‘localhost‘ (using password: NO)
idea提示java.sql.SQLException: Access denied for user ''@'localhost' (using password: NO) 首先检查数据库的密码是否 ...
- 解决java.sql.SQLException: Access denied for user ‘***‘@‘localhost‘ (using password: YES)
有可能是你创建的SpringBoot项目中,自带的propertirs文件中定义了账号密码为***,然后你又自己定义了yml文件,项目读取的是propertirs中的用户名密码,把propertirs ...
- java.sql.SQLException: Access denied for user ‘‘@‘localhost‘ (using password: YES)问题
我用的是c3p0出现了这个错误 参考这个文章 把username=root 改为 user=root 测试成功 综上所述 dbcp,c3p0,druid,hikari等可能对properties的us ...
- java.sql.SQLException: Access denied for user ‘‘@‘localhost‘ (using password: YES) 出现原因和解决办法
今天我在学习SSM的时候,在测试时发现 在这里发现账号密码没有 问题 程序中加载完毕数据库配置文件后,获取数据库配置文件中的变量不一致. 改正后 就是粗心的原因,导致读取不到账号密码,或者你其他的地方 ...
- 解决java.sql.SQLException: Access denied for user ‘‘@‘localhost‘ (using password: NO)
出现如下错误: 错误原因: application.properties中数据库的用户名和密码格式写错 错误的形式 正确的形式
最新文章
- 【译】OpenDaylight控制器:YANG Schema和Model
- Windows环境下QWT安装及配置
- codeforces E. Game with String 概率
- BZOJ[1051]受欢迎的牛
- 被面试官问的Android问题难倒了,系列篇
- ERROR 1064 (42000): ; check the manual that corresponds to y
- Presto在滴滴的探索与实践
- Proteus软件仿真学习——整流桥电路
- Qt 控件添加右键菜单
- c 自动打印的服务器,C-Lodop云打印服务器 x64
- 作业中关于H5中动画的实现——animation
- Django由一查多
- 浙江高考python 学生采访_实录|我采访了12个在校大学生,高考前100天他们这样过...
- 『已解决』.NET报错:所生成项目的处理器框架“MSIL”与引用“wdapi_dotnet1021”的处理器架构“AMD64”不匹配
- 3ds Max: Advanced Materials 3DS Max 教程之高级材质 Lynda课程中文字幕
- 咱也谈谈如何炒股,如何买股票呗。
- 优启通 v3.7.2022.0106 官方22年1月VIP版
- 钢铁厂计算机相关岗位需要倒班吗,3个钢铁厂员工血泪史:宁愿工资少一点,千万别上夜班...
- 数据库(DB)、数据库管理系统(DBMS)、MySQL、SQL之间的关系
- 紫金军团终得胜 神奇科比傲联盟